The physical safety and security of our children is of paramount concern. With that in mind, professional security patrol of all school entrances and perimeter are secured and monitored. These well trained security guards are in constant contact with the school office and administration, as well as with their own security headquarters. They also understand the mindset of children, and create an atmosphere of naturalness and ease.

Staff and parents are required to wear photo identification badges when on school grounds. Anyone not wearing a Maimonides Academy badge is required to enter the school through the main office where a temporary badge is issued. Badges and photos, for new parents, may be obtained in the front office. Replacement badges may be ordered through the front office for a moderate fee.

In addition, Maimonides Academy has created a Parent Security Committee. Part of the committees responsibility, is to ensure that all security related concerns are satisfactorily addressed in a proactive manner.

All cars picking up Maimonides Academy children during carpool must display, on the windshield of their car, a permanent Maimonides Academy identification (ID) sticker. No child is released to a car without an ID sticker. Maimonides ID stickers are available in the front office for all parents who's children attend Maimonides Academy. Our children's welfare can only be fully addressed when school and parents work hand-in-hand. Maimonides will expect and enforce total parental cooperation with regard to school security needs and procedures.

Additionally, all cars in the Maimonides Academy parking lot, as well as cars parked on Beverly Place, must also display the permanent Maimonides Academy ID sticker in their window. Any vehicle not displaying this ID sticker will quickly be towed away for security reasons.
